How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 92116?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 92116 Studio Apartments | $2,419 | $1,725 | $3,818 |
| 92116 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,872 | $1,400 | $6,596 |
| 92116 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,633 | $1,350 | $9,387 |
| 92116 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,643 | $2,500 | $6,535 |
